Michael "Big Mike" Calhoun Sr., peacefully departed this life on November 15, 2024, at the age of 62. Michael was born in Cincinnati, Ohio, on November 23, 1961, to the late Elmer "Buddy" and Joan "Mama Jo" Calhoun. He grew up in Woodlawn and attended school in the Princeton City School District from Elementary through High School. During High School he also attended Scarlet Oaks Vocational School where he studied brick masonry.

Michael's early career spanned various jobs, from bakery crafts to dock work, and he worked tirelessly until his health began to decline. Throughout his life, his infectious energy and vibrant smile made him a cherished presence in every room he entered. He was known for his warm heart, quick wit, and sense of humor that could light up even the darkest days.

A true car enthusiast, Michael had a deep passion for cars, always eager to work on them and attend car shows. He could often be found tinkering with an engine or admiring a classic model. But his greatest gift wasn't just his skills or his love for cars—it was his generosity. Michael would give you the shirt off his back if you needed it, always putting others first. His thriftiness and ability to turn a little into a lot made him a trusted and dependable friend, and he was never fooled by appearances, always seeing things for what they truly were.

Michael had an incredible ability to keep in touch with people from all stages of his life. If you asked him about someone from his childhood, he'd give you a detailed rundown of their story, proving his love for connection and his unwavering loyalty to those he cared about. His kindness knew no bounds, and he made everyone feel like family. But what truly set Michael apart were the special nicknames he gave to his family members and friends, each one a reflection of his deep affection and playful spirit.

Michael is survived by his beloved sons, Bryant Rucker and Joshua Calhoun; grandchildren Michael III, Bryant Rucker Jr., and Bre'asia Rucker; sisters Patricia Jones, Lafawn Calhoun, Renee Perry, Jeneen (Stanley) West; brothers Darryl Calhoun, Dwayne Hall, and Terry (Sherri) Calhoun; and aunt Elaine Menifee; along with a host of nieces, nephews, and extended family who loved him deeply. He was preceded in death by his son, Michael Calhoun II, and his sister, Delexa Calhoun.

Michael will be dearly missed by his family, friends, and all who had the privilege of knowing him. His memory will live on in the hearts of those who loved him and in the many lives he touched with his selflessness and vibrant spirit.
